Tilting Perspectives: The Aesthetic of Geometric Harmony

From honeycombs in nature to urban skylines, geometric forms have long shaped our perception of beauty and order. Among them, the octagon stands out—a shape that balances complexity and simplicity, offering visual harmony without rigidity. Unlike squares or circles, the eight-sided form introduces subtle movement, creating dynamic focal points in static environments. Today’s designers are embracing this balance, turning to octagonal design as a symbol of modern sophistication. Its symmetrical structure brings calmness, while its angularity adds energy—making it ideal for spaces where tranquility meets innovation.

The growing popularity of octagonal motifs in interiors reflects a deeper shift toward mindful design. Shapes influence mood; sharp edges energize, curves soothe, and the octagon? It centers. With its equal sides and soft angles, it fosters equilibrium—an essential quality in fast-paced modern life.

Octagonal Inspiration in Home Decor

Interior spaces come alive when layered with thoughtful geometry. Wall art featuring interlocking octagons can transform a blank surface into a textured narrative, drawing the eye across planes and depths. Furniture pieces—from coffee tables to shelving units—crafted with octagonal silhouettes introduce architectural interest without overwhelming minimal settings. Whether rendered in matte black metal or warm walnut wood, these designs anchor a room with quiet confidence.

This versatility allows octagonal elements to thrive across diverse styles. In Scandinavian interiors, they add gentle structure amidst soft textiles. In industrial lofts, their precision contrasts beautifully with raw materials. Even in traditional Eastern-inspired rooms, the eight-sided motif resonates with cultural symbolism—echoing ancient concepts of balance and infinity.

For smaller homes, the octagon is a secret weapon. Its multi-directional presence creates the illusion of expanded space, guiding light and gaze outward. A single octagonal shelf or rug can redefine proportions, making compact areas feel intentional and expansive.

Functional Beauty: Practical Products Reimagined

Beauty need not sacrifice utility—and few designs prove this better than the octagonal storage box. Combining clean lines with ergonomic corners, these containers offer smooth stacking and easy handling, all while serving as decorative accents on shelves or desks. Available in woven rattan, powder-coated steel, or polished resin, they adapt seamlessly to bathrooms, offices, or entryways.

Mirrors and lighting fixtures also benefit from this shape. An octagonal mirror amplifies natural light through multiple reflective planes, brightening dim corners and adding depth. Pendant lamps with octagonal frames cast intricate shadows, turning ceilings into canvases of pattern and rhythm. Even everyday objects like drinkware and serving trays adopt the form with flair—each edge designed for comfortable grip and stable placement.

The Mind Behind the Shape: Design Logic Unfolded

Designers gravitate toward the octagon not just for its looks, but for its inherent stability and visual magnetism. Eight sides provide more contact points than hexagons, enhancing structural integrity—especially crucial in load-bearing furniture or modular systems. Yet, unlike complex polygons, the octagon remains instantly recognizable, ensuring immediate aesthetic impact.

Material choice further elevates the experience. Brushed brass lends luxury; bamboo brings warmth; tempered glass offers transparency and airiness. Craftsmanship matters too—precision joinery, seamless welding, or hand-finishing details ensure each product feels as premium as it looks. Most importantly, user-centric thinking guides every curve and corner, prioritizing comfort in touch, ease in use, and harmony in placement.

Beyond Interiors: The Wider Appeal of Eight Sides

The octagon’s influence extends far beyond furniture. In fashion, bold handbags and sleek watches feature octagonal faces, echoing timeless craftsmanship with a modern twist. Architecturally, buildings incorporate octagonal courtyards and skylights to optimize airflow and daylight. Public installations use the shape for both acoustics and visual rhythm, proving its relevance in large-scale design.

In tech, smartwatches adopt octagonal screens for improved readability and wrist ergonomics. Packaging designers leverage the form for luxury gift boxes—distinctive, memorable, and effortlessly upscale.

Bringing Octagonal Style Into Your Space

Introducing octagonal pieces into your home starts with intention. Choose items that reflect your existing palette—matte finishes for muted schemes, metallics for contrast. Pair them with circular rugs or rectangular sofas to create pleasing juxtapositions. For maximal effect, group several octagonal elements together—a gallery wall of framed prints, a cluster of hanging planters, or nested side tables.

Feeling creative? Try a DIY project: paint an octagonal accent wall, build a floating shelf using reclaimed wood, or stencil patterns onto fabric. These personal touches make the geometry truly yours.

The Future of Octagonal Design

Looking ahead, sustainability and technology will shape the next wave of octagonal innovation. Modular furniture built from recycled plastics uses octagonal joints for strength and disassembly, supporting circular design principles. Smart mirrors with embedded displays integrate octagonal borders to frame information elegantly within living environments.

Young designers are pushing boundaries too—merging streetwear influences with heritage shapes, or using augmented reality to visualize octagonal layouts before production. As lifestyle evolves, so does the language of design—and the octagon remains at the forefront, blending tradition, function, and future-thinking style.
